Description

Butanedioic Acid, (4-Ethylphenyl)- (9Ci) is a specialized organic acid derivative, also known as 4-Ethylphenylsuccinic Acid. This compound serves as a valuable chemical intermediate and building block in advanced organic synthesis. It is primarily utilized by the pharmaceutical and agrochemical industries for the research and development of active ingredients and fine chemicals.

Basic Information

Item Details
Product Name Butanedioic Acid, (4-Ethylphenyl)- (9Ci)
CAS No. 704205-92-5
Molecular Formula C12H14O4
Molecular Weight 222.24 g/mol
Synonyms 4-Ethylphenylsuccinic Acid; (4-Ethylphenyl)butanedioic Acid; 2-(4-Ethylphenyl)succinic Acid; 1-Carboxy-3-(4-ethylphenyl)propanoic Acid; p-Ethylphenylsuccinic Acid; Succinic acid, (4-ethylphenyl)-; Butanedioic acid, (4-ethylphenyl)- (9CI)
